Members of the rural community say the Scottish Government needs to work with them on how best to control deer numbers.
It comes after the government axed proposals to extend the deer culling season over fears pregnant animals could have been killed.
The British Association for Shooting and Conservation says it still has concerns about other deer management plans within the Natural Environment bill.
